This is a reminder to come on out this evening and talk to your Board of Education at our E-SPLOST Q&A session on at 5:00 p.m. The session will be held at the Board of Education Building at 100 D.B. Carroll Street, Jasper. E-SPLOST is an Education Special Purpose Local Option Sales Tax that has been in existence since 1997 in Pickens County. For more information, please visit our website at https://www.pickens.k12.ga.us/page/esplost and please vote on March 18th.
